OCA Laminator: Techniques and Best Practices
To achieving optimal bonding with an OCA laminator , several essential techniques and proven practices must be observed. Accurate substrate cleaning is critical ; verify all the display and that protective layer are lacking dust and contaminants . Heat and compaction settings necessitate careful tuning based on the specific bonding agent and components being employed . Frequent maintenance of this adhesive laminator , including cleaning rollers and inspecting calibration, is just as crucial to consistent outcomes .

Troubleshooting Common Issues in LCD Laminators
Addressing typical problems with LCD machines often requires basic inspections . A unsuccessful bonding can be resulting from several elements , including incorrect warmth calibrations, inconsistent force , or a soiled roller . Initially , confirm the temperature is at the suggested range for the specific film . Next, examine the rollers for any buildup and scrub them completely . Finally, assess the force setting ; a inadequate setting may produce substandard lamination.
